Concrete Slab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on a single concrete slab Yes No DIY cleaning solutions can usually handle small water stains.
Large areas of water damage on multiple concrete slabs No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le large water damage areas.
Visible signs of m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th need professional equ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ent future growth.
Water damage has affected insulation or drywall No Yes Water damage to insulation or drywall needs professional equipment and expertise to safely remove and repair.
Concrete slab water extraction is not done quickly, leading to further damage No Yes Delaying concrete slab water extraction can lead to costly repairs and further damage.
Homeowner lacks experience and equipment to handle concrete slab water extraction No Yes Professional concrete slab water extraction needs specialized equipment and expertise.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ction Cost In Norwood, MA

The cost of concrete slab water extraction services in Norwood, MA varies based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our prices are estimates, and ex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Contact us today for a free estimate and to learn more about our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Concrete Slab Water Extraction (small area) $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Concrete Slab Water Extraction (large area) $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Mold and Mildew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Insulation and Drywall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Concrete Slab Replacement $5,000 – $20,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Emergency Response (after-hours or weekend service) 10% – 20% more fee Time of day, day of week

How can I prevent concrete slab water damage?

To prevent concrete slab water damage, make sure to regularly inspect your property’s concrete slabs for signs of water damage, such as cracks or water stains. Also, ensure that your property’s drainage system is functioning properly and that your gutters are clear of debris.
